Etymology 2

Sino-Korean word from (point; dot)

Noun

(jeom) (hanja )

  1. a point or spot
  2. point or aspect
  3. a dot or period

Etymology 3

Korean reading of various Chinese characters.

Syllable

(jeom)

  1. : occupying
    (eumhun reading: 차지할 (chajihal jeom), MC reading: (MC t͡ɕiᴇm, t͡ɕiᴇmH))
  2. : shop
    (eumhun reading: 가게 (gage jeom), MC reading: (MC temH))
  3. /: Alternative form of (dot)
    (eumhun reading: (jeom jeom), MC reading: /)
  4. : gradually
    (eumhun reading: 점점 (jeomjeom jeom), MC reading: (MC t͡siᴇm, d͡ziᴇmX))
  5. : sticky
    (eumhun reading: 끈끈할 (kkeunkkeunhal jeom), MC reading: (MC ɳˠiᴇm))
  6. : wet
    (eumhun reading: 젖을 (jeojeul jeom), MC reading: (MC ʈˠiᴇm))
  7. : mountain pass
    (eumhun reading: (jae jeom), MC reading: )
  8. : catfish
    (eumhun reading: 메기 (megi jeom), MC reading: (MC nem))
